Who are The Ninety-Nine Cent Players?

We are a team of theatre lovers bringing performance and production opportunities to fellow theatre lovers in New Jersey.

We produce plays and musicals for NJ audiences with local performers, creatives, and musicians!

Whether we are putting on an original work or a beloved piece, we are driven by powerful stories and the impact that can be made on a community when those stories are brought to life. We are less concerned with all the bells and whistles—elaborate sets or costumes—and instead are more interested in directing the attention to the heart of a story.

In 2019, a talented group of alumni from Bridgewater-Raritan High School decided to put on a summer production of Godspell—thus, The Ninety-Nine Cent Players were born!

Founded on a mixture of low-budget necessity and passionate, creative scrappiness, that production opened to local acclaim, and tickets quickly sold out.

After a pandemic pause, The Ninety-Nine Cent Players returned in the summer of 2023 with Disney’s Beauty and the Beast, which played a sold-out run at the Martinsville Community Center, and the following year a run of Rodgers & Hammerstein’s Oklahoma! at the Watchung Arts Center.

We look forward to bringing more theatre to NJ in our 2025 season!
